22 Course Content:
Week Theoretical Practical
1 Definite indefinite integral and basic concepts
2 Simple integration rules. Examples
3 Changing variables. Examples
4 Partial integration. Examples
5 Separation by simple fractions. Examples
6 Trigonometric transformations. Examples
7 Binomial integrals, fundamental theorems of integral. Examples
8 An overview.
9 Midterm
10 Definition of definite integral and basic concepts
11 Lower and upper sums, Riemann integral
12 Variable replacement, partial integration and so on.
13 Spring length and Area account
14 Area and volume of rotary surfaces
